wire eroder, also known as wire electrical discharge machining (WEDM), is a cutting-edge technology that uses a thin, electrically charged wire to cut through hard materials with precision and accuracy. This innovative machining process has revolutionized the manufacturing industry by offering a cost-effective and efficient solution for producing intricate and complex parts. In this article, we will explore the ins and outs of wire eroder technology and how it is shaping the future of manufacturing.
wire eroder works by using a thin wire electrode that is electrically charged and guided along a programmed path to cut through the workpiece. The wire is typically made of brass or copper and is energized by a power supply to create electrical discharges that erode the material. This process is highly controlled and can produce parts with tight tolerances and intricate designs that are not achievable with traditional machining methods.
One of the key advantages of wire eroder technology is its ability to cut through hard materials such as titanium, stainless steel, and carbide with ease. This makes it an ideal choice for industries that require high precision and quality, such as aerospace, automotive, and medical device manufacturing. wire eroder can also be used to remove broken drills and taps from workpieces without damaging the surrounding material, saving time and money in the production process.
